Read MoreAMANDA is a classic wooden motor yacht homeported in Piraeus, Greece. Built in 1956 in the U.K., she was refitted in 2017 to her original layout. Further refit work was performed in 2018. Read MoreWHEN and IF, the Alden schooner whose build was commissioned by World War II General George Patton to sail on a circumnavigation he didn’t live to take, has joined the Nicholson fleet.
